390596565151231960640950291871057870006402
Even
390596565151231960640950291871057870006402 is even
Previous even number is 390596565151231960640950291871057870006400
Next even number is 390596565151231960640950291871057870006404
Cubed
59591629282094910543027654461859744688338852834484332678265736046457653426381549537407470977210653271326856892162972829836808
Squared
152565676707940593712011870600471192096715872976841046291468880426053924967520985604
Binary
1000111101111011100001100100001100110010110101100110011101111111110110010110000101011101111111010010001100011011001101001110010100010000010